Abstract

This utility model is a quick-release hook for a protective case, comprising a female base with an upper end and a lower end, the lower end having a mounting hole and a mounting portion formed near the mounting hole at the lower end. The upper end of the female base is disposed on the protective case. A male base includes a connecting portion and a rotating portion. One end of the connecting portion can be selectively connected to or separated from the mounting portion, and one end of the rotating portion is rotatably connected to the other end of the connecting portion. Thus, when a lanyard is connected to the male base of this utility model and inserted into the female base, it is convenient for the user to hang and carry the item, providing quick and easy installation and removal. Because the rotating portion can rotate, the lanyard can be positioned relative to the male base, thus preventing the lanyard from becoming tangled due to repeated rotations and crossings during use.

Technical Field

[0001] This utility model relates to a quick-release hook, and more particularly to a quick-release hook for a mobile phone protective case. Background Technology

[0002] Modern mobile phone parts are sophisticated and expensive, so most users purchase a protective case when they buy a phone to provide further protection against drops or scratches. For ease of carrying and use, mobile phone lanyard accessories are available on the market. These accessories mainly consist of a buckle and a lanyard. The buckle has a protrusion for attaching a buckle. Users clip the buckle between the phone case and the phone, with the protrusion extending out of the charging port pre-drilled in the protective case, thus creating a buckle structure on the phone case. Users then hook the lanyard onto the buckle, allowing them to hang the phone on their person for easy carrying and access.

[0003] To prevent the aforementioned buckle from occupying part of the charging port space and affecting the phone's charging function, the manufacturer has also developed a separate phone lanyard accessory set. It mainly includes two female connectors and one male connector lanyard. The female connector has a buckle structure and can be inserted into two speaker holes that are fixed to the protective case. The two ends of the male connector lanyard are respectively equipped with hook structures and are fastened to the two female connectors by hooks. In this way, in addition to having the same lanyard function to make it convenient for users to carry, it can also avoid blocking the charging port and affecting the charging function.

[0004] However, both of the aforementioned types of mobile phone lanyard accessories share the same drawbacks. Firstly, because the angle between the lanyard and the buckle is fixed, the lanyard is prone to tangling during prolonged user movement or shaking. This requires the user to untangle the tangled lanyard to use the phone, causing considerable inconvenience. Secondly, the overall structure of the hook type is bulky. When a phone with the lanyard attached is placed on a table, the width of the hook structure is greater than the thickness of the phone, causing it to tilt unevenly and preventing the phone from lying stably. In addition, the hook can easily rub against clothing, damaging the surface or causing a foreign body sensation to the wearer. Therefore, improvements are needed to address these problems and drawbacks. Utility Model Content

[0030] Please see Figure 1 As shown, the quick-release hook for the protective shell of this utility model includes a female seat 10 and a male seat 20.

[0031] Please see Figure 2 and Figure 3 As shown, the female base 10 is a long ring-shaped body with an upper end 11 and a lower end 12. The upper end 11 has an annular flange 111, and the width of the upper end 11 is greater than the width of the lower end 12. The lower end 12 has a mounting hole 121, and a mounting portion 122 is formed on the lower end 12 adjacent to the mounting hole 121. In this embodiment, the mounting portion 122 is a protruding structure that protrudes from the inner edges of the two opposite ends of the mounting hole 121, but it is not limited thereto.

[0032] Please see Figures 2 to 4 As shown, the male seat 20 includes a connecting part 21 and a rotating part 22. The connecting part 21 includes a housing 211, at least one connecting member 212, and an elastic member 213. The shape of the housing 211 corresponds to the shape of the female seat 10. It has a receiving space and an upper opening 214 communicating with the receiving space, at least one side opening 215, and at least one side opening 24. In this embodiment, the two side openings 215 are arranged opposite each other from left to right, and the two side openings 24 are arranged opposite each other from front to back. The side openings 24 are elongated holes, but this is not a limitation. A connecting rod 216 protrudes from the bottom end of the housing 211. The outer peripheral surface of the connecting rod 216 is recessed to form an annular groove 217. In this embodiment, there are two connecting parts 212, but this is not a limitation. Each connecting part 212 includes a hook portion 218 and a pressing portion 219. The hook portion 218 is in the shape of a barb, and the pressing portion 219 is a long rod. The hook portion 218 protrudes from one end of the pressing portion 219 and extends laterally before bending to be approximately parallel to the pressing portion 219. The two connecting parts 212 are disposed opposite each other in the housing 211, and the pressing portion 219 protrudes through the side opening 215. An elastic element 213 is disposed between the two connecting parts 212. [0033] The rotating part 22 includes a rotating rod 221, a sleeve 222, and a ring 223. One end of the rotating rod 221 extends laterally to form a movable space, and a connecting hole 224 is provided on the end face, which is connected to the movable space. The other end of the rotating rod 221 is a hollow cylindrical body, and at least one fixing hole 225 is provided laterally. The outer wall surface of the other end of the rotating rod 221 is formed with external threads. The sleeve 222 is a hollow tube with internal threads. The sleeve 222 is fitted onto the rotating rod 221 and fixed by the combination of internal and external threads. The rotating part 22 is fitted onto the connecting rod 216 of the housing 211 through the connecting hole 224, and the C-shaped ring 223 is fitted onto the annular groove 217 on the connecting rod 216, thereby achieving a rotatable connection. However, this is not a limitation, and the form of the rotating part 22 can be changed according to the user's needs.

[0035] The male seat 20 is inserted into the mounting hole 121 of the female seat 10 by the user pressing the pressing part 219 of the connecting member 212, causing the two hook parts 218 to come closer together. After insertion, the user releases the hand, causing the two hook parts 218 to separate due to the elastic force of the elastic member 213. The hook parts 218 hook onto the mounting part 122, achieving a quick connection function. When the user wants to remove the hanging rope 40, they only need to press the two pressing parts 219 again to quickly detach the male seat 20 from the female seat 10. Figure 8 As shown, in addition to the convenience of quick assembly and disassembly, because the rotating part 22 can rotate, the hanging rope 40 can rotate relative to the housing 211 of the male seat 20. Therefore, the user can prevent the hanging rope 40 from getting tangled due to multiple rotations and crossings during use.

[0037] In the aforementioned process, since both the male seat 20 and the female seat 10 are flat, the overall thickness can be reduced, thus preventing the phone from tilting up when placed on a table.

[0038] During the aforementioned process, even when the phone case 30 is connected to the lanyard 40, the side opening 24 of the seat 20 can have the function of discharging the sound emitted by the phone speaker, thus preventing the sound from being blocked.

[0039] Please see Figure 9 As shown, this is another embodiment of the present invention, wherein the female seat 10 is the same as the aforementioned embodiment, the main difference being that the shell 211A of the male seat 20A is different. Specifically, the shell 211A of the male seat 20A further forms two wings 23A, which are disposed opposite to each other at the two ends of the shell 211A near the side opening 215A and extend toward the bottom to form a sheet-like structure. In this way, when the user applies pressure to the pressing part 219A to insert or pull out, the wings 23A can provide more support to the hand to improve the user's operating feel.
